Converts D and E zero-field splitting parameters described in the abstract of http://dx.doi.org/10.1063/1.1682294 into a diagonal spin interaction matrix.

Syntax

M=zfs2mat(D,E,alp,bet,gam)

Arguments

D,E - real scalar parameters, Hz

   alp  - alpha Euler angle in radians
   bet  - beta Euler angle in radians
   gam  - gamma Euler angle in radians

Outputs

M - diagonal 3x3 matrix
